What is nutritional yeast used for?

Nutritional yeast is a yellow, flaky powder that is often used as a cheese alternative. It is a source of protein and vitamins, and is often used by people who are vegetarian or vegan. Nutritional yeast can be used in many different ways, including as a topping for popcorn or as an ingredient in vegan cheese sauces.

Nutritional yeast is a deactivated yeast that is popular as a vegan cheese substitute. It is a source of B-vitamins and is often used as a nutritional supplement.

Does nutritional yeast have MSG

There’s a reason why nutritional yeast is often compared to cheese. It contains naturally occurring MSG, which is the sodium version of glutamic acid. Glutamic acid is responsible for the umami flavor, which is why nutritional yeast often has a cheesy flavor.

Can nutritional yeast cause depression

Nutritional yeast is a type of yeast that is often used as a dietary supplement. It is rich in vitamins and minerals, and has a variety of health benefits. However, there are a few confusions that people have about nutritional yeast. First, nutritional yeast is not the same as regular yeast. Nutritional yeast is a deactivated yeast, which means it can’t be used for baking. Second, nutritional yeast is often sold in flake form, but it can also be bought in powder form. Lastly, nutritional yeast is often fortified with vitamin B12, so it’s a good option for vegetarians and vegans.
